Neon Lights and River Rhythms
Our first stop has just gotta be Austin, the live music capital of the world and the wonderfulest city in Texas. They say "Keep Austin Weird," and honey, they mean it. You can stroll down South Congress Avenue where hippie shops sell tie-dye everything and vintage boots, feelin' the easy-breezy energy that makes everyone feel right at home. When the sun starts to dip, the bats come swoopin' out from under the Congress Bridge like a free concert for your soul. Between the breakfast tacos that’ll make you cry happy tears and the brisket so tender it melts your worries away, your belly and your heart will be full to burstin'.
Roll on down the road to San Antonio, where history meets riverfront romance. The Alamo stands proud, but the real magic is along the River Walk. With string lights twinklin’ over the water, it feels like a fairy tale with a Southern drawl. The people here are as warm as fresh tortillas, blendin' old traditions with that fierce Texas pride. Whether you're sippin' a margarita that packs a punch or wanderin' the Pearl District for some farm-to-table treats, San Antonio whispers stories of the past while you watch the boats glide by.
Urban Melting Pots and Cowboy Culture
Now, don’t sleep on Houston, darlin’. It’s a space city that’s as diverse as a Texas wildflower field. It’s a beautiful melting pot where you’ll hear every accent under the sun and taste the world on a plate. From the Vietnamese spots in Bellaire that hug your soul to the funky, creative haven of Montrose where rainbow flags wave proud, Houston has an energetic pulse that keeps you movin’. It’s a place where big-city hustle meets small-town friendliness, provin’ once again that we’re all part of one big tribe.
For that cowboy-meets-culture fix, you’ve gotta swing through Dallas and Fort Worth. Dallas sparkles with its skyscrapers and the flower power of the Arboretum, while Fort Worth’s Stockyards keep the Western spirit alive with cattle drives and honky-tonks. The folks here might be sharp-dressed, but they’re down-to-earth and quick with a "yes ma’am." It’s the perfect place to grab a slice of pecan pie and soak in that Texas-sized ambition wrapped in genuine hospitality.
The Wild Heart of the West
Head west, y'all, to the rugged, soul-stirrin’ masterpiece that is Big Bend National Park. This ain’t your average park; it’s a place of deep canyons and views that stretch on forever, makin’ you feel tiny and infinite all at once. You can hike the Lost Mine Trail or soak in the natural hot springs by the Rio Grande like the hippie adventurer you are. The people out here are salt-of-the-earth types—ranchers and nature lovers with hearts as open as the sky.
"Big Bend whispers ‘slow down, darlin’' and you’ll listen, chasin’ sunsets painted in pinks and golds, feelin’ connected to somethin’ bigger."
Out here, life is simple and satisfyin’. You might find yourself havin' roadside tacos from a friendly local or packin' a picnic with local honey from nearby Marfa. Whether you’re glamping under a stargazin’ roof or stayin’ in an old-West hotel, the desert has a way of healin’ you. It reminds us to breathe and just be.
Wildflowers and Wine in the Hill Country
Last but never least, we find our way to the Texas Hill Country for a slower, sweeter pace. Think rollin' hills, vibrant wildflowers, and wineries where you can sip local vino while listenin' to live music. In places like Fredericksburg, the German roots mix perfectly with Texas charm. You can hike up Enchanted Rock for a view that’ll fill your spirit or just sit on a porch wavin’ at the neighborly folks passin’ by.
This is the land of peach cobbler and barbecue joints with lines out the door. It’s where you kick off your shoes, breathe deep, and let the magic of the land work on you. Stay in a cozy B&B, watch the sunrise with a cup of coffee, and remember that life is meant to be savored.
